Choosing a Pentax Long Telephoto
Posted By Marc Langille
Replies: 21
Views: 3,319
I would humbly suggest that the FA* 250-600/5.6 is or can be of prime sharpness. Of course YMMV with your technique, support setup(s), etc. Having shot with the Sigma 500/4.5 and the FA* 300/2.8, my FA* 250-600/5.6 loses a stop or two of light, but not sharpness. :)

Some are taken at F5.6 aperture. I tend not to shoot this lens wide open, given the narrow DOF and the subjects being so close.

FA* 600 F4 Softness at F4 Issue
Posted By Marc Langille
Replies: 44
Views: 4,429
Glad to hear a positive outcome on this matter.

Feedback from Mark:
"The 600 f4 was always soft wide open. The only time it was ok for me to shoot f4 was when the target was not moving. It was very easy to misfocus when the depth of field was so slim."

EDIT: Mark also shied away from the 560mm for his needs: "...That thing could never be used for sports because it has misfocus issues and awfully slow"
Things may have improved on the focusing issue, he may have tried a bad copy, not sure?

I concur about the narrow depth of field issue, in addition anything else that may be going on with the lens.My subjects were often less than 6m/20ft away, often very small. I'll probably end up buying the 150-450mm as a excellent long lens option for travel.

For those eligible, you have 2 options, by phone or e-mail...
  1. Customer Support phone: 619.725.3150 - follow the prompts. They're staffed from 8:30-4:30, PST.

  2. Go to this webpage and fill it out: Nik Collection - Support


NOTE: today was the first day I got through on the phone. You may wish to try the web form, since I received a verification e-mail within 5-10 minutes of submitting it. I received my download link to the free Nik Collection upgrade today - approximately 48 hrs. The web page form is probably the easiest contact method. There is no longer a serial number requirement, since I wasn't prompted to activate anything after installing it. It's working as is... others have mentioned this.

I did get on the phone today to speak about a refund on the purchase. It took a bit of time, and I had to be transferred over to another, internal department. Both reps confirmed they've been inundated, so please be patient. I received my RMA confirmation for my purchase order of $149 ($126.65 with coupon), and it will post within 2 weeks. Again, they're swamped right now - Zach indicated that anyone and everyone is calling, so you can only imagine. My call finished in 22 minutes, but I was also involved with a refund (RMA).
